What is the engine model of the Tiggo 8?

The engine code of the Tiggo 8 is SQRE4T15B (abbreviated as E4T15B). Here is an introduction to the Tiggo engine: 1. It is a 4-cylinder gasoline engine, which is an improved version of the 1.5T engine with the code E4T15 currently used in the Tiggo 7. 2. The product collaborates with renowned component suppliers such as Honeywell, Valeo, and Bosch, and has undergone comprehensive optimization in aspects like the combustion system and cooling system, achieving a thermal efficiency of up to 37.1%. Currently, this engine holds a leading position in terms of technology among domestic brands.

I've been driving a Tiggo 8 for three years now. I remember my car is the 2021 model, equipped with a 1.6T engine, model SQRF4J16. The power is quite strong, with quick acceleration and relatively low fuel consumption. It feels very stable when driving on the highway. Later, a friend bought the new model, which uses a 1.5T SQRE4T15C engine. The horsepower is slightly lower, but it's more fuel-efficient. Chery's engine design is quite good; it doesn't consume much fuel in daily city driving, usually around 8 liters per 100 kilometers. For maintenance, I recommend regular oil changes and checking the turbo components, as these engines can occasionally have carbon buildup issues. Addressing them promptly prevents any major problems. Overall, the engines in Tiggo 8 models may vary by year, so when buying, you can check the engine cover or manual to confirm the model.

What Causes the Gurgling Water Sound When a Car Shuts Off?

The gurgling water sound when a car shuts off is caused by gases remaining in the cold exhaust pipe that are waiting to be re-burned. There are several situations where sounds occur after the car is turned off: 1. Cooling sound of the three-way catalytic converter: After the car is turned off, the three-way catalytic converter gradually stops working, the temperature drops, and the internal metal components expand and contract due to heat, causing unusual noises; 2. Cooling sound of the exhaust pipe: When the car is idling cold, the exhaust pipe expands and contracts due to heat, producing unusual noises; 3. Turbo cooling sound: The rapid rotation and friction of the turbo during acceleration generate high temperatures, and after shutting off the engine, the heat expansion and contraction become very noticeable, causing unusual noises; 4. Uneven engine cooling noise: The engine temperature is very high, and after shutting off, the temperature of various components drops at different rates, causing the gaps between internal metal parts to contract and rub, producing unusual noises.

How to Add Coolant to a Car Radiator?

Method for adding coolant to a car radiator: 1. Open the radiator's drain valve to release all the antifreeze inside. Insert a tube into the radiator to flush it with water. While flushing, fully release the accelerator pedal to keep the engine idling until clear water comes out of the radiator. 2. Close the drain outlet and start adding antifreeze to the radiator until it is full, not exceeding the marked level, then tighten the cap. 3. Start the engine, open the radiator cap, and let the engine idle for two to three minutes to expel some air from the radiator. If the antifreeze level starts to drop, continue adding antifreeze, then replace the cap.

What brand is Polestar?

Polestar is a jointly owned brand by Volvo Car Group and Geely Holding Group. The models under the Polestar brand include the Polestar 1 and Polestar 2. The Polestar 1 is a plug-in hybrid sports car, with dimensions of 4586 mm in length, 2023 mm in width, and 1352 mm in height, and a wheelbase of 2742 mm. In terms of power, the Polestar 1 is equipped with a 2.0-liter twin-charged engine, delivering a maximum power of 240 kW and a maximum torque of 435 Nm. The engine features direct fuel injection technology and uses an aluminum alloy cylinder head and block. For the suspension, this car uses a double-wishbone independent suspension at the front and a multi-link independent suspension at the rear.

How to lift up the wiper of Emgrand GL?

Method to lift up the wiper of Emgrand GL: First, turn on the power by inserting the key. After turning off the engine, push the wiper switch downward. The wiper will automatically stop when it reaches the top position, and then you can lift the wiper manually. The wiper, also known as the windshield wiper, is a device used to wipe off raindrops and dust attached to the vehicle's windshield, improving the driver's visibility and enhancing driving safety. What Causes Oil Inside the Throttle Body?

Oil inside the throttle body occurs because, during engine operation, some combustible air-fuel mixture can leak through the gap between the cylinder and piston rings due to pressure differences. If not vented in time, this can lead to excessive pressure inside the engine. Therefore, every engine is equipped with a crankcase ventilation valve, which allows excess combustible mixture to be expelled through the PCV (Positive Crankcase Ventilation) valve and recirculated back into the intake manifold to participate in combustion. The throttle body is a controllable valve that regulates air intake into the engine. After entering the intake pipe, the air mixes with fuel to form a combustible mixture for combustion and power generation. As a critical component of fuel-injected engine systems, the throttle body is located between the air filter (above) and the engine block (below), acting as the "throat" of the engine. The responsiveness of acceleration is closely related to the cleanliness of the throttle body.

What is a Car Suspension?

Car suspension refers to a connecting structural system between the car body, frame, and wheels. This system includes components such as shock absorbers, suspension springs, anti-roll bars, suspension subframes, lower control arms, longitudinal links, steering knuckle arms, rubber bushings, and connecting rods. When a car travels on the road, it experiences vibrations and impacts due to changes in the road surface. Some of these impact forces are absorbed by the tires, but the majority are absorbed by the suspension system between the tires and the car body. The function of the suspension system is to transmit forces and torques acting between the wheels and the frame, while also cushioning the impacts transmitted from uneven road surfaces to the frame or body and dampening the resulting vibrations, ensuring smooth driving.
